2
彩民我有細節的數字像這樣:四捨五入問題在SSRS
Sales Amount
£285.00
£16,249.51
£345.68
但總的返回信息:
£16,880.18
,而我所期待的:
£16,880.19
這是應該是細節的總和,但最後一個數字是四捨五入的。我如何克服這個限制?
彩民我有細節的數字像這樣:四捨五入問題在SSRS
Sales Amount
£285.00
£16,249.51
£345.68
但總的返回信息:
£16,880.18
,而我所期待的:
£16,880.19
這是應該是細節的總和,但最後一個數字是四捨五入的。我如何克服這個限制?
因爲你圓你的,你可以使用下面的表達式小數點後第二位的細節(表達式更改字段以符合您自己)
Sum(Round(Fields!val.Value,2))
的另一個選項是在你的SQL代碼四捨五入數據集
是的,試過之前,仍然得到相同的錯誤 – dLight
請提供更多信息,如舍入前的數字 – niktrs
爲了這個工作,你真的必須把你的細節和總數。我的猜測是細節被格式化爲貨幣,但它背後的實際數據有許多小數位。當你達到你的總和時,小數點下降而不是上升。就像這個答案所表明的那樣,首先圍繞細節。 – Jesse